A low-born, abject person.

In fiction, a character who has the role of being bad, especially antagonizing the hero; an antagonist who is also evil or malevolent.

Any opponent player, especially a hypothetical player for example and didactic purposes. Compare: hero (the current player).

Archaic form of villein (feudal tenant, peasant, serf).

To debase; to degrade.
